Charles A. Bieneman, partner of Rader, Fishman & Grauer PLLC, a leading national intellectual property law firm, has launched ?The Software Intellectual Property Report,? found on the World Wide Web at http://swipreport.com. Rader, Fishman & Grauer develops strategies for maximizing the value of intellectual assets including patents, trademarks, copyrights and trade secrets. Clients range from multinational corporations to emerging enterprises.

The focus of this new e-publication will be the intersection of software and intellectual property law. As Mr. Bieneman noted, ?There are a lot of blogs out there covering intellectual property law, and a few covering software issues, but there really isn?t much focusing on the nexus between those two.?

Mr. Bieneman explained that software patents were almost a topic unto themselves, but added ?The SWIP Report is going to cover much more than that.? Mr. Bieneman plans for the new blog to cover issues ranging from protecting software to software licenses to cloud computing, with special attention to the impact on software of the traditional ?Big Four? of intellectual property law: patents, copyrights, trademarks, and trade secrets. Initial posts cover software patents, software licensing issues, and concerns about cloud computing customer agreements.

?The Software Intellectual Property Report? offers a free e-mail newsletter that will be sent on a periodic basis. Anyone can sign up for the newsletter by going to http://swipreport.com and clicking on the ?Subscribe? link. An RSS feed is also available.

Mr. Bieneman currently serves as 2011-2012 Chair of the State Bar of Michigan Information Technology Law Section. Prior to joining Rader, Fishman & Grauer, he was a patent examiner with the U.S. Patent and Trademark office, where he examined claimed inventions in the areas of computer software, databases, and the World Wide Web. Mr. Bieneman holds a J.D., cum laude from University of Michigan Law School, B.S. in Computer Science from University of Maryland and a Bachelor of Arts from St. John?s College in Sante Fe.
